diff --git a/js/build_package.js b/js/build_package.js index e06f84dc..8db31abb 100644 --- a/js/build_package.js +++ b/js/build_package.js @@ -1,15 +1,7 @@ #! /usr/bin/env node -const fs = require("fs"); +const fs= require("fs"); -// We copy file to the new directory -fs.mkdirSync("pkg"); -for (const file of fs.readdirSync("./pkg-web")) { - fs.copyFileSync(`./pkg-web/${file}`, `./pkg/${file}`); -} -for (const file of fs.readdirSync("./pkg-node")) { - fs.copyFileSync(`./pkg-node/${file}`, `./pkg/${file}`); -} const pkg = JSON.parse(fs.readFileSync("./pkg/package.json")); pkg.name = "oxigraph"; diff --git a/js/package.json b/js/package.json index 72310055..5a81afa5 100644 --- a/js/package.json +++ b/js/package.json @@ -10,7 +10,7 @@ "scripts": { "fmt": "biome format . --write && biome check . --apply-unsafe && biome format . --write", "test": "biome ci . && wasm-pack build --debug --target nodejs && mocha", - "build": "rm -rf pkg && wasm-pack build --release --target web --out-name web --out-dir pkg-web && wasm-pack build --release --target nodejs --out-name node --out-dir pkg-node && node build_package.js && rm -r pkg-web && rm -r pkg-node", + "build": "wasm-pack build --release --target web --out-name web && wasm-pack build --release --target nodejs --out-name node && node build_package.js", "release": "npm run build && npm publish ./pkg", "pack": "npm run build && npm pack ./pkg" },